Warning Signs You Need Thermal Imaging Leak Detection
Don’t ignore these warning signs, they could be indicative of hidden water damage that needs immediate attention.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ent odor that won’t go away, it’s time to call our team. We’ll use Thermal Imaging Leak Detection to identify the source of the leak and repair any dam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, don’t ignore it. Our team will use Thermal Imaging Leak Detection to identify the source of the leak and repair any damage.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in your walls or ceilings, don’t wait. Our team will use Thermal Imaging Leak Detection to identify the source of the leak and repair any damage.
Increased Water Bills
Increased water bills can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s time to call our team. We’ll use Thermal Imaging Leak Detection to identify the source of the leak and repair any damage.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age, such as water pooling or water spots, can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in your property, don’t wait. Our team will use Thermal Imaging Leak Detection to identify the source of the leak and repair any damage.
